The following committees are looking for dynamic and committed volunteers to carry out new projects.

  • National philanthropy day (NPD) committee : The National Philanthropy Day Committee is in charge of preparing the ceremony during which outstanding philanthropic contributions are rewarded. It is responsible for physically, materially, and financially organizing the event. It shares with the executive committee the responsibility to recruit speakers. All directors are required to participate to ensure that the event runs smoothly. Communications related to the event are supported by the Communications Committee.
  • Membership committee : The Membership Committee focuses on ensuring that members have a full understanding of the benefits of membership to AFP International and the Quebec chapter. We promote membership to AFP through outreach to fundraising professionals and by advocating the benefits of a professional organization to potential members. Activities include recruiting new members, stewardship of current members, and promoting membership at chapter events. We encourage individual membership that represents a broad spectrum of local charities and non-profits. The committee shall meet quarterly to strategize and plan recruitment activities.
  • Sponsorship committee : The Sponsorship Committee implements the necessary tools to ensure that AFP attracts major sponsors to support its mission. With the approval of the Board of Directors, it designs the visibility plan for partners and ensures that the standards and promises agreed upon are met and fulfilled. It is also in charge of sponsor selection, follow-up and satisfaction.
  • Diversity committee : The Diversity and Inclusion Committee supports the implementation of inclusive practices by AFP Quebec and its members at the philanthropic and organizational levels. Working in partnership with Chapter committees, members, and community stakeholders, we ensure that diverse communities are engaged, represented, and supported in philanthropy through leadership, membership, mentorship, and professional development activities.
